Skip to content

RosAclRuleProps

Properties for defining a RosAclRule.

See https://www.alibabacloud.com/help/ros/developer-reference/aliyun-waf-aclrule

Initializer

import com.aliyun.ros.cdk.waf.RosAclRuleProps;
RosAclRuleProps.builder()
    .domain(java.lang.String)
    .domain(IResolvable)
    .instanceId(java.lang.String)
    .instanceId(IResolvable)
    .rules(java.lang.String)
    .rules(IResolvable)
//  .region(java.lang.String)
//  .region(IResolvable)
//  .ruleId(java.lang.Number)
//  .ruleId(IResolvable)
    .build();

Properties

Name Type Description
domain java.lang.String OR com.aliyun.ros.cdk.core.IResolvable No description.
instanceId java.lang.String OR com.aliyun.ros.cdk.core.IResolvable No description.
rules java.lang.String OR com.aliyun.ros.cdk.core.IResolvable No description.
region java.lang.String OR com.aliyun.ros.cdk.core.IResolvable No description.
ruleId java.lang.Number OR com.aliyun.ros.cdk.core.IResolvable No description.

domainRequired

public java.lang.Object getDomain();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

instanceIdRequired

public java.lang.Object getInstanceId();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

rulesRequired

public java.lang.Object getRules();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

regionOptional

public java.lang.Object getRegion();
  • Type: java.lang.String OR com.aliyun.ros.cdk.core.IResolvable

ruleIdOptional

public java.lang.Object getRuleId();
  • Type: java.lang.Number OR com.aliyun.ros.cdk.core.IResolvable